Aberrated Imaging and Propagation |
Ders Kodu |
OPE560 |
Ders Açıklama |
Fundamentals of Image Formation: Diffraction theory of image formation with emphasis on aberrations, Compare diffraction and geometrical PSFs and OTFs, Strehl, Hopkins, and Struve ratios, Asymptotic behavior of PSF. Imaging by systems with circular pupils: Aberration-free PSF and beam focusing, Strehl ratio and aberration balancing and tolerance, Zernike circle polynomial expansion of aberration function, Aberrated PSF and its symmetry properties, Encircled and ensquared power, Aberrated OTF and Hopkins ratio, Line of sight and centroid of PSF of an aberrated system, Line-spread function and Struve ratio, Polychromatic PSFs and OTFs. Imaging by systems with annular pupils: Discuss similar topics as for systems with circular pupils, including Zernike annular polynomials. Imaging by systems with Gaussian pupils: Effect of Gaussian apodization on PSF and OTF, Zernike-Gauss polynomials and aberration balancing, Propagation of Gaussian beams. Random Aberrations: Random image motion, Fabrication errors, Propagation through atmospheric turbulence. |
